- FAMILY SHOTS:
If you want some family photos or group photos then let your photographer know, decide the important photos you want and ensure there is enough time to have these taken. The more people and the more photos you want, the longer it takes, so ensure there is plenty of time.

You can help your photographer by having the groomsmen help get the right people over for the photos that are needed. Letting your photographer know allows them to find a good location and backdrop for these photos beforehand, saving time and making it easier on the day.

- If you have any special requests or specific photos you are after I’ll be happy to hear and discuss.

- SURPRISES!
Surprises are great for guests and your other half, however, it is always better to let your photographer in on the secret.

Whatever it is be it fireworks at the end of the night, or a special dance let your photographer know, so they can be ready to capture it from the best angle, if they know what is coming they can plan for it ensuring they get the best photos possible of the surprise and reaction on your guests' faces.
